引言
在当今快速发展的数字化时代,数据已成为推动社会进步的关键因素。特别是在交通出行领域,数据的价值愈发凸显。向量数据库作为一种新型的数据库技术,正逐渐革新着交通出行体验。本文将深入探讨向量数据库在交通出行领域的应用,以及它如何为人们带来更加便捷、高效、安全的出行体验。
向量数据库简介
1.1 定义
向量数据库是一种专门用于存储和查询高维空间中数据的数据库。它通过将数据项表示为多维向量,利用向量空间模型进行数据的索引和查询。
1.2 特点
- 高维空间支持:向量数据库能够处理高维空间中的数据,如文本、图像、音频等。
- 快速查询:通过向量空间模型,向量数据库能够实现高效的查询操作。
- 空间关系分析:向量数据库支持空间关系分析,如相似度计算、聚类等。
向量数据库在交通出行领域的应用
2.1 实时路况分析
向量数据库可以存储大量实时路况数据,如交通流量、车速、道路状况等。通过分析这些数据,可以为驾驶员提供实时路况信息,帮助他们选择最优出行路线。
# 示例代码:使用向量数据库查询实时路况
def query_traffic_data(vector_db, query_vector):
"""
查询向量数据库中的实时路况数据
:param vector_db: 向量数据库实例
:param query_vector: 查询向量
:return: 查询结果
"""
# 这里用伪代码表示查询操作
results = vector_db.query(query_vector)
return results
2.2 智能交通信号控制
向量数据库可以用于存储和分析交通信号灯控制数据,如信号灯变化周期、相位、配时等。通过分析这些数据,可以为交通信号控制提供优化建议,提高交通效率。
2.3 智能导航
向量数据库可以存储大量地图数据,如道路、交通设施、地标等。结合智能导航算法,可以为用户提供个性化的出行路线推荐。
2.4 自动驾驶
在自动驾驶领域,向量数据库可以用于存储和查询车辆感知数据,如摄像头、雷达、激光雷达等。通过分析这些数据,可以帮助自动驾驶系统更好地理解周围环境,提高行驶安全性。
向量数据库的优势
3.1 高效查询
向量数据库通过向量空间模型,能够实现高效的查询操作,大大缩短了数据检索时间。
3.2 强大的空间关系分析能力
向量数据库支持空间关系分析,如相似度计算、聚类等,为交通出行领域提供了丰富的分析工具。
3.3 良好的可扩展性
向量数据库具有良好的可扩展性,能够适应交通出行领域不断增长的数据量。
总结
向量数据库作为一种新型的数据库技术,在交通出行领域具有广泛的应用前景。通过利用向量数据库的优势,我们可以为人们带来更加便捷、高效、安全的出行体验。随着技术的不断发展,向量数据库将在交通出行领域发挥越来越重要的作用。
